Here is a bag I just finished for my daughter Rhonda. It's called the Professional Bag. Very large, middle zipper pocket plus 5 other pockets inside and 5 pockets outside. I've never broken so many needles on one project before. It's about 14 inches tall and 18 inches wide.

When we lived in Georgia we had a lot of hummingbirds coming and going. Even had them follow me in the house one day when I was going to change the feeder!! That was scary. One immediately went back out, but the little girl got scared and was flying around in the window. I was so relieved when she finally went back outside. In the video below, the little boy sat on Mike's finger. He did later for me too. What a doggone thrill!!
